Transaction 3bce2a38e50415e80ba0b6f2ce6f2007d74892a8fef6ed3b2d70a86b2725fc20

50 Input
1 Outputs
  • 3bce2a38e50415e80ba0b6f2ce6f2007d74892a8fef6ed3b2d70a86b2725fc20:0
  • value  1386454240
    address  3Mf7vRzkLwMAXWZTBvvUDrurRkz8k9G8KL